    Diffrence between LEDS and Neons?

    LEDs consume less power, are more pure in light color and have "instant on/off" which is good for strobing or flashing effects. The newer "chip" LEDs don't have the spot pattern typical of the 5mm/3mm models. Good Call...we're a wierd bunch over there.

    need help fast

    There should be a wiring harness behind the underhood fuse box that goes through the firewall. In many cases there's enough room in the gromet for a 4 awg wire or smaller. To get big wire through, I like to use about 3 feet of thick stranded 12 gauge wire to probe my way through the firewall...
